2.1. How Do I Become an Automotive Technician in West Bend?

To become an automotive technician, start with a high school diploma or GED, then enroll in an automotive technology program at a vocational school or community college. These programs provide the necessary skills and knowledge to diagnose and repair vehicles. Completing an apprenticeship can also provide valuable hands-on experience. Certification from 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) is highly recommended and often required by employers.

2.2. What Skills Are Needed to Succeed in Auto Repair?

To succeed in auto repair, you need a combination of technical skills and soft skills. Technical skills include diagnostic abilities, mechanical aptitude, and knowledge of automotive systems. Soft skills include problem-solving, communication, and customer service. The ability to stay updated with the latest automotive technology and repair techniques is also crucial.

2.3. What Is the Earning Potential for Auto Mechanics in West Bend?

The earning potential for auto mechanics in West Bend varies based on experience, certifications, and specialization.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for automotive service technicians and mechanics was $46,830 in May 2022. Experienced technicians with ASE certifications and specialized skills can earn significantly more. Owning your own auto repair shop can also substantially increase your income.

3.3. What Certifications Are Important for Auto Repair Technicians?

Certifications from 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) are highly important for auto repair technicians. ASE certification demonstrates competence and professionalism, and it is often required by employers. There are different ASE certifications for various areas of automotive repair, such as engine repair, brakes, electrical systems, and heating and air conditioning. Maintaining these certifications through ongoing education is essential for staying current in the field.

4.2. What Licenses and Permits Are Required to Operate an Auto Repair Shop?

Operating an auto repair shop typically requires several licenses and permits, including a business license from the city of West Bend, a state sales tax permit, and an EPA identification number if you handle hazardous waste. You may also need specialized permits for specific services, such as refrigerant handling or emissions testing. Check with the Wisconsin Department of Transportation and the local city hall for specific requirements.

4.3. How Much Does It Cost to Start an Auto Repair Shop in West Bend?

The cost of starting an auto repair shop in West Bend can vary widely depending on the size and scope of your business. Key expenses include:

  • Rent or Purchase of a Facility: $3,000 – $10,000 per month.
  • Equipment: $50,000 – $200,000 for lifts, diagnostic tools, and other equipment.
  • Inventory: $10,000 – $30,000 for parts, supplies, and tires.
  • Licenses and Permits: $500 – $2,000.
  • Insurance: $2,000 – $10,000 per year for liability, property, and workers’ compensation insurance.
  • Marketing: $1,000 – $5,000 per month for advertising and promotions.

6.1. How Are Electric Vehicles Changing the Auto Repair Industry?

Electric vehicles (EVs) are changing the auto repair industry by:

  • Requiring New Skills: Technicians need specialized training to work on EVs, including knowledge of high-voltage systems, battery technology, and electric motors.
  • Reducing the Need for Some Services: EVs have fewer moving parts than gasoline-powered vehicles, reducing the need for services like oil changes and spark plug replacements.
  • Increasing the Demand for Other Services: EVs require specialized services like battery diagnostics, battery replacements, and charging system repairs.
  • Creating New Safety Concerns: Working on EVs involves high-voltage systems that can be dangerous if not handled properly.
  • Driving the Adoption of New Technologies: EV repair requires specialized diagnostic tools and equipment, driving the adoption of new technologies in the auto repair industry.

6.2. What Is the Role of Technology in Modern Auto Repair?

Technology plays a crucial role in modern auto repair, including:

  • Diagnostic Tools: Advanced diagnostic tools use sensors, software, and data to quickly and accurately identify problems with vehicles.
  • Digital Vehicle Inspections (DVI): DVI systems allow technicians to perform comprehensive inspections using tablets and software, providing customers with detailed reports and photos.
  • Cloud-Based Data: Access to cloud-based data provides technicians with real-time information about vehicle specifications, repair procedures, and technical bulletins.
  • Telematics: Telematics systems collect data about vehicle performance and driving behavior, allowing technicians to remotely diagnose problems and provide proactive maintenance recommendations.
  • 3D Printing: 3D printing is being used to create custom parts and components for vehicles, reducing the need for expensive and time-consuming manufacturing processes.

7.3. How Do I Obtain ASE Certification?

To obtain ASE certification:

  • Meet the Requirements: You must have at least two years of hands-on experience in the automotive field or one year of experience and a two-year degree in automotive technology.
  • Pass the Exams: You must pass one or more ASE certification exams, which cover various areas of automotive repair.
  • Maintain Certification: To maintain your ASE certification, you must retake the exams every five years or complete continuing education courses.

8.1. What Insurance Coverage Is Required for Auto Repair Shops?

Required insurance coverage for auto repair shops typically includes:

  • General Liability Insurance: Protects against claims of bodily injury or property damage caused by your business operations.
  • Garagekeepers Insurance: Covers damage to customers’ vehicles while they are in your care, custody, or control.
  • Workers’ Compensation Insurance: Provides benefits to employees who are injured on the job.
  • Commercial Property Insurance: Protects your business property, including buildings, equipment, and inventory, from damage or loss.
  • Commercial Auto Insurance: Covers vehicles owned and used by your business.

8.2. What Environmental Regulations Must Auto Repair Shops Follow?

Auto repair shops must follow environmental regulations related to:

  • Hazardous Waste Disposal: Proper disposal of used oil, antifreeze, batteries, and other hazardous materials.
  • Air Emissions: Compliance with regulations related to air emissions from painting and other processes.
  • Water Pollution: Prevention of water pollution from spills and runoff.
  • Refrigerant Handling: Proper handling and disposal of refrigerants, such as Freon.
